Nigerian Breweries Bags KNSG Award for Providing Multimillion Naira CSR

By Our Correspondent

Kano State Government through its Government Technical College has given an award to the Nigerian Breweries Plc for it continues support in education and human oriented projects.

 Kano State Deputy Governor Professor Hafiz Abubakar who also doubles as Commissioner for Education Science and Technology was ably represented by the Executive Secretary Science and Technical Schools Board Alhaji Ahmed Tijani Abdullahi at the Commissioning of the block of class rooms, library, laboratory, Toilets and bole holes built and donated by Maltina brand under Nigerian Breweries Plc.

Abdullahi who presented the award on behalf of GTC, revealed that ‘’the Kano  Government Technical College decided to award Maltina a brand of Nigerian Breweries Plc. for its support in education pointing that the company in 2014 also built and donated similar projects at Government Secondary School, Bachirawa and today we are also commissioning another gigantic block of class rooms with state of the art facilities, libraries well equipped , laboratories and toilets, like I said this award is for their support for human development especially in a crucial sector like Education’’

Abdullahi also stated that the state has been lucky to get 125 of such donations from individuals, students associations, PTA and corporate bodies. ‘’we have received 53 donations from individuals, 30 from students associations, 25 from Parent Teachers’ Associations and 17 from corporate bodies numbering 125’’

He further reiterated the commitment of the Ganduje led administration in ensuring education for all via continues partnership with individuals, corporate bodies and group stressing that the partnership with corporate bodies like Nigerian Breweries Plc. has reduced the congestion of pupils/students in classrooms from 90 to 40 per class with more quality of learning materials.

Speaking at the event Managing Director Nigerian Breweries Plc. Nicolaas Vervelde who was represented by the Public Affairs Manager, North Mr. Danjuma John-Ekele said ‘’ We are proud to be a veritable partner to Kano State. Kano is Special to us – supporting us towards achieving our business success. Kano is home to Maltina in the North. And this year, we are having our third straight educational project in Kano with the first in Government Secondary School, Bachirawa, Ungogo Local Government in 2014; Government Girls Secondary School, Badawa in 2015 and today, Government Technical College – our premier Technical school destination in Northern Nigeria’’

 

‘’We have gathered here today at GTC Kano to commission and handover the school structures provided by Nigerian Breweries Plc.

 

‘’The new facilities include: newly constructed block of 5 classrooms, toilets, borehole and library furniture and renovated Physics and Chemistry labs that will serve the school.  It also pleases me to inform you that the classrooms and library are furnished with students’ desks, chairs and tables for teachers, with provision of text books.

 

‘’Thus, in the last three (3) years, we have provided 17 Classrooms, about 340 student desks catering to an average of 1,020 students per session, 2 Libraries, over 300 book titles, 2 Staff rooms, 2 boreholes, 16 toilets …(and counting) to three (3) schools in Kano. This is a significant social investment milestone for any company and we have done it in Kano.          He stressed.

 

Recalled that ‘’This month alone, in the North, NB Plc. have commissioned a hospital block with a delivery couch, mattresses, filing cabinets in Makera Health Care Center, Kaduna; block of 6 classrooms & furniture, a lab, library & books, toilets and borehole in Government Science and Technical College, Bukuru, Jos; another block of 6 classrooms & furniture, a staff room & furniture, library & books and toilets in Government Senior Secondary School, Kofar Yandaka, Katsina.
